Yanks Sign 1B Ensberg

The Yankees have signed yet another 1B to add to the mix, in the way of Morgan Ensberg. Ensberg, 32, split last season between the Houston Astros and the San Diego Padres. He has primarily played third base in his career, but the Yankees would be looking at him as a first baseman. With San Diego, Ensberg finished his season batting .230 with 12 home runs and 39 RBIs in 115 games. A .265 ...

Yankees sign Morgan Ensberg
Morgan Ensberg finished fourth in the NL MVP voting in 2005, helped the Astros reach the World Series. But his career has tumbled, hurt in part by a 2006 shoulder injury. Now the Yankees are taking a low-risk chance on him.
